Transaction e120f96d6aa38175f78901c7140ca77ddf30c55d54f6fafecdccffe00d4283f7
1 Input
1 Output
-
e120f96d6aa38175f78901c7140ca77ddf30c55d54f6fafecdccffe00d4283f7:0
- value
- 16191
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9761bc81656cbff6d1b4fdbf031e11ed9ae83b6 OP_EQUAL
- address
- 3MWr3VfAFbdaHMK3Tk4osb41aj78A5hAU7